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of experimental equipment technology, and more specifically, to a constant temperature mixer. Background Technology
[0002] A homogenizer is a widely used laboratory device whose main function is to thoroughly mix, stir, and uniformly disperse sample solutions to ensure the accuracy and reliability of experimental results. In practical applications, the homogenization process of some media requires a long time due to their physical or chemical properties, which affects experimental efficiency to some extent. By increasing the temperature of the medium, the reaction rate can be significantly accelerated, thereby shortening the homogenization time and improving experimental efficiency.
[0003] Chinese patent CN 221182657 U discloses a constant temperature mixer, which integrates a test tube cover mechanism on the main unit for fixing test tubes. A limiting plate is provided at the top of the guide rod. When installing test tubes, the operator needs to pull the cover 32 to the position defined by the limiting plate to provide space for the test tubes. However, the operator must manually hold the test tubes and insert them into the bottom of the cover 32 for placement. During this process, the presence of the cover 32 can obstruct the operator's view to some extent, increasing the difficulty and uncertainty of test tube placement and affecting the convenience and efficiency of the operation. [0022] like Figures 1-5 As shown, a constant temperature mixer includes a main body 100, an mounting plate 101 is mounted on the top of the main body, a plug box 102 is fixedly connected to the mounting plate, a plurality of test tubes 103 are inserted into the plug box, and the main body can drive the test tubes to shake. The above technical features are all existing technologies, such as the MK-3000 constant temperature mixer produced by Hangzhou Aosheng Instrument Co., Ltd.
[0023] In at least one embodiment, the main body is provided with two guide rods 1, which are respectively located on both sides of the plug-in box. A top cover 2 is rotatably connected between the two guide rods, and a sponge test tube cover 3 is provided at the bottom of the top cover. Supporting components are provided on the guide rods.
[0024] Furthermore, the guide rod is equipped with a rotating shaft 11, and a top cover is rotatably connected between the two rotating shafts. The design of the rotating shaft allows the top cover to rotate around it, facilitating the placement and removal of test tubes by the operator.
[0025] In a more detailed design, the support member restricts the rotation of the top cover around the pivot axis. This design effectively limits the rotation range of the top cover, ensuring it can be stably fixed in the desired position when not in use, thus improving operational convenience and safety.
[0026] In at least one embodiment, the support member includes a rotating plate 4 and a fixed plate 5. The rotating plate is rotatably connected to the guide rod, and the fixed plate is fixedly connected to the guide rod. The rotating plate is located above the rotating shaft, and the fixed plate is located below the rotating shaft. An adjusting bolt 6 is threadedly connected to the fixed plate.
[0027] Furthermore, the rotating plate includes a rotating ring 41, with a mounting hole 42 formed in the center of the rotating ring, and an upper limit plate 43 formed on one side of the rotating ring. The design of the rotating ring allows the rotating plate to rotate easily around the guide rod, while the design of the upper limit plate effectively restricts the upward rotation of the top cover, ensuring the stability of the top cover.
[0028] In a more detailed design, the guide rod is provided with an external thread, and a rotating plate is threadedly connected to this external thread. The external thread of the guide rod mates with a mounting hole, allowing the rotating plate to achieve a rotatable threaded connection with the guide rod via the mounting hole.
[0029] Furthermore, the fixing plate includes a fixing ring 51, with a positioning hole 52 formed in the middle of the fixing ring, and a lower connecting plate 53 formed on one side of the positioning hole. The lower connecting plate has a threaded hole 54. The fixing ring can accommodate the guide rod, and the fixing plate is fixedly connected to the guide rod by argon arc welding at multiple spot welds on the fixing ring. When the upper cover rotates to a horizontal position, the sponge test tube cap contacts the top of the test tube, the lower connecting plate adheres to the bottom of the upper cover, and the upper limit plate rotates to the top of the upper cover to restrict the rotation of the upper cover around the axis. The cooperation of the lower connecting plate and the upper limit plate effectively restricts the rotation of the upper cover, ensuring the stability of the upper cover in a horizontal position.
[0030] The solution is further refined, and the threaded hole is internally threaded with an adjusting bolt.
[0031] To test the operation, confirm that the main body, mounting plate, connector box, and test tubes of the thermostatic mixer are all properly installed and in normal working order. When placing or removing test tubes, first rotate the rotating plate to rotate the upper limit plate 180°, thus releasing the rotation restriction on the top cover. Next, rotate the top cover around the axis to open it to a suitable position. After opening the top cover, test tubes can be easily placed or removed. Afterward, rotate the top cover back to the horizontal position so that the sponge test tube cap contacts the top of the test tube. Rotate the rotating plate again to rotate the upper limit plate to the top of the top cover, thus restricting the top cover's rotation around the axis.
[0032] If necessary, the upward tilt angle of the top cover can be adjusted by turning the adjusting screw for better observation or handling of the test tubes.
